About the Role We're looking for an experienced and impact-driven Head of Engineering to lead our growing US engineering team as we scale Monzo across the US market.
This is a unique opportunity to shape the future of our product in the US.
You'll lead and scale a full-stack team that's already live with checking, savings, and money management tools; serving 150,000 customers and retaining strongly.
We're now entering our next phase of growth in the US and aiming to reach millions of customers over the next few years.
You'll report directly to the US CEO and work closely with senior leaders across product, design, marketing and operations.
You'll be responsible for engineering performance and execution in the US, with the autonomy to make technical and product decisions locally—while also benefiting from Monzo's proven UK platform, tools and infrastructure.

Initial Call (1 hour) You'll meet one of our Senior leadership team (Either our US CEO or VP of Eng in the UK).
We'll ask you about your previous experience, in particular people leadership, your experience building technology and products and gauging two-way interest.Loop Stage (3 hours) The Loop stage consists of 3 x 60 min interviews that take place over 1-2 days depending on your availability.
(details below)Loop Stage info:
-Team and Org Management (1 hour)An example based interview with 1-2 engineering leaders.
They're interested to hear examples from your previous experience on the teams you've led, how you've shaped and partnered with other functions like Product and Design, and the impact you had.
-Technical Project Deep Dive (1 hour)You'll take an engineer through a project which you're most proud of.
It should be something you implemented or contributed significantly to.
It could be highly technical or a product feature that had a large engineering component.
-Behavioral (1 hour)Similar to Team and Org Management, this is an example based interview with leaders from the US team.
This interview focuses on your people leadership style.
Our average process takes around 3-4 weeks but we will always work around your availability.

Classification of protected categoriesis as follows:
A "disabled veteran" is one of the following: a veteran of the U.S. military, ground, naval or air service who is entitled to compensation (or who but for the receipt of military retired pay would be entitled to compensation) under laws administered by the Secretary of Veterans Affairs; or a person who was discharged or released from active duty because of a service-connected disability.
A "recently separated veteran" means any veteran during the three-year period beginning on the date of such veteran's discharge or release from active duty in the U.S. military, ground, naval, or air service.
An "active duty wartime or campaign badge veteran" means a veteran who served on active duty in the U.S. military, ground, naval or air service during a war, or in a campaign or expedition for which a campaign badge has been authorized under the laws administered by the Department of Defense.
An "Armed forces service medal veteran" means a veteran who, while serving on active duty in the U.S. military, ground, naval or air service, participated in a United States military operation for which an Armed Forces service medal was awarded pursuant to Executive Order 12985.

Why are you being asked to complete this form?We are a federal contractor or subcontractor.
The law requires us to provide equal employment opportunity to qualified people with disabilities.
We have a goal of having at least 7% of our workers as people with disabilities.
The law says we must measure our progress towards this goal.
To do this, we must ask applicants and employees if they have a disability or have ever had one.
People can become disabled, so we need to ask this question at least every five years.
Completing this form is voluntary, and we hope that you will choose to do so.
Your answer is confidential.
No one who makes hiring decisions will see it.
Your decision to complete the form and your answer will not harm you in any way.
If you want to learn more about the law or this form, visit the U.S. Department of Labor's Office of Federal Contract Compliance Programs (OFCCP) website at .
How do you know if you have a disability?A disability is a condition that substantially limits one or more of your "major life activities." If you have or have ever had such a condition, you are a person with a disability.
